Lift the restrictions against people going on ocean cruises
Closed
462 signatures
What the petition asks
Currently government advice is against UK residents and nationals going on an ocean cruise following the Covid pandemic. Government should lift the restriction that currently prevents people from going on an ocean cruise.
Cruise lines have been on pause since March 2020 and as a result, many are starting to have to consider the future of the company involved and the future of their ships. This could result in many lines being forced to cease operating altogether, which has a knock-on effect on the economy - both local and national - and employment.
